On February 9, a woman's body was found on a bench in a Berlin park. The Ukrainian embassy soon announced that the deceased was a 40-year-old Ukrainian citizen. This was first reported by the German media Tagesschau and Welt .
According to German police and prosecutors, the incident was reported at around 3:30 a.m. At the scene, officers found a woman covered in blood and dead from injuries to her upper body. A male suspect, who the victim was likely acquainted with, was also detained in the park.
The homicide department is currently investigating. Officially, German authorities have not revealed the identities of either the deceased or the suspect. At the same time, the Ukrainian Embassy in Berlin confirmed that both are Ukrainian citizens, and the case is being investigated as a possible murder and is being monitored.
The diplomatic institution noted that the embassy is in constant contact with German law enforcement agencies and provides support to the family of the deceased.
